This wedding was down in San Francisco also back in March (at the InterContinental Hotel), and for this wedding the setup was the Platinum Package (two 15-inch subs with two 12 inch tops), light bar on Gravity stand, Everse 8 as my side-fill speaker, a 50watt monogram projector (on Gravity stand), 14 wireless uplights (to fill the large room), and a single wireless pinspot light to highlight the cake. 🪩
This was the first gig using the Gravity stands, and I’ve used them at every event since (they’re great!). While the 50watt projector puts out a bright projection, I’ve since switched to only using digital monograms (as the clarity on traditional gobo projectors just isn’t as sharp on large walls as I would like). I’m only using the traditional projectors for texture gobos now (texture projections are patterns like leafs, ferns, snowflakes, etc, which they do perfectly). 📽️
